There are over 2,800 newspapers that have been published in the Old Dominion - certainly not all of them are searchable online. But there are many that are indeed available. So go for it - find articles about the events, history, and people that capture the stories of Virginia.

The Library of Virginia and the Virginia Newspaper Project have collaborated to make available online, many newspapers published in Virginia from the various Civilian Conservation Corps (CCC) camps throughout the state from 1934 to 1941.
